Chapter Nineteen

Back at the inn, Xie Yuan slammed her room door shut without any hesitation, locking Song Ling, who had been following her, out.

Go back to your room and reflect on your actions.

"Master, did I make you angry again?" Song Ling's eyelashes trembled slightly as she stood obediently outside the door, clutching her things, her voice somewhat forlorn.

"No, I'm angry with myself." Xie Yuan poured herself a cup of tea, took a sip, and sat down at the table, rubbing her temples to calm herself. The boy's figure was still reflected on the window paper of the door, seemingly with no intention of leaving. "I don't want to see you right now. You should go back and stay there."

"Master..." He sounded like he was about to cry.

Xie Yuan usually couldn't stand his pitiful and aggrieved tone. People say that a loving mother spoils her son, but she was more like a loving teacher spoiling her student.

The main problem is that her mind is in a mess right now. On one hand, it's because she, as his teacher, hasn't provided him with positive guidance. On the other hand, she's also a little angry at herself for being so weak-willed. She really doesn't know how to calmly talk to him and steel herself to utter those two words.

"Go away."

It's one thing if Song Ling doesn't understand, but as her teacher, she can't just blindly follow along and make a mess of things.

She practically raised him!

Even if I were to take a step back, even if I were to be tempted by beauty, I wouldn't be so desperate as to let it be my own disciple.

Having never experienced a real master-disciple romance while reading novels, Xie Yuan couldn't understand why some masters would rather die than submit, leading to so many tragic love stories. Now that the novels have become reality, she's truly become more honest.

Fortunately, she was a transmigrator, otherwise most people would find it hard to accept. Only after experiencing it firsthand did they realize how incredibly immoral it was.

Especially when someone is perfectly fine and suddenly, out of nowhere, they blurt out a few words that make people blush and their hearts race, all while sporting such a handsome face—who could resist that?

It's not that she's overthinking, it's that she really can't help but overthink!

Song Ling never plays by the rules, and whenever she gets annoyed, she can only verbally scold him.

She would never dare to joke about how she would leave him if he continued like this.

Doesn't her own apprentice know this?

Deep down, he's actually crazy and ruthless. When they were kids, he didn't mind letting her see it; he tried every way to show her his "monster-like, inhuman" side, hoping to make her back down and kill her...

Xie Yuan sighed in frustration. It was all over. Even though she was the master, she felt like she was the one being completely controlled.

Feeling troubled, Xie Yuan could only sit on the couch to meditate and calm her mind, while also making the most of her time to cultivate.

It must be said that this body's foundation is somewhat lacking, but it is indeed a good seedling suitable for cultivation, and it is very compatible and well-suited to the skills she previously cultivated.

Outside the door.

Song Ling's delicate profile was shrouded in a faint, lingering shadow because of her words.

These days he has indeed been constantly testing her limits, trying to see how much she can tolerate his unreasonable behavior.

He had considered the worst-case scenario.

But so what? That makes it even less likely that we'll let her leave, doesn't it?

Song Ling casually wiped away the faint trace of blood spreading from the corner of her mouth, then turned and went into the next room.

"611, get out here."

Within the realm of consciousness, a handsome young man in black appeared out of thin air, exuding a chilling aura like a ghost.

611 had just returned from wandering around in another world and was trembling with fear at his icy tone: "Host... is there anything you need?"

Ahhhhh, although its host is very powerful, it is really scary, sob sob sob!

"How's the mission progressing?"

611's voice was barely audible: "Host, the protagonist's aura has been weakened to 45% by you, and it no longer has any effect on you."

"Do I need to care about this?"

Even though it was just a wisp of consciousness, it felt itself trembling uncontrollably, and immediately replied, "Thank you... Lord Xie Yuan, your liking for you is 80%, and your heart-fluttering value is 20%."

Song Ling's voice was as cold as ice that never melts over the Cangshan Mountains and Erhai Lake: "Why is it still so low?"

611 humbly explained, "Host, this is really not low. Lady Xie Yuan likes you, but her feelings for you as a master far exceed what you want..." It spoke softer and softer, timidly observing his expression from the shadows.

"Why is the host so fixated on Xie Yuan's kind of affection? Isn't this better now? Doesn't she like you a lot now too?"

611 mustered its courage and asked the question it had had since he brought it to this world: Over the years, its host had repeatedly traveled back to different parallel worlds, killing countless people. It initially thought its host had become too corrupted and bloodthirsty, but later learned he was searching for someone...

Song Ling's black silk robe was lifted and fell by the surging waves without getting a single hem wet. His self-deprecating laughter mingled with the roar of the tsunami in this lifeless space.

“My master was the best at deceiving me. Her sweet words were more powerful than anyone I had ever met. She even managed to lure me, who had already awakened to self-awareness at that time, into her trap without my knowledge.”

"She once promised me that she would give me a home, but she broke her promise. My home was destroyed, and I no longer have a master."

"However, when everything started over and she never came back, I finally understood that everything I saw in my dream about my ending was real."

"This world wants me to be a dutiful, obedient piece of trash, someone who gets killed and manipulated at will."

"Ha, how laughable. How can these ants arbitrarily determine the fate of my life and death?"

"So what if the sky is destroyed? As for the person I want, even if her soul is scattered and she no longer belongs to this world, I will never let her go."

611 suddenly understood what was going on and cautiously asked, "So, is this the reason why the host awakened me and made me devour another system, seize its memories, and replace everything about it?"

"Its memory is incomplete, but it is a fact that Master is not from this world. Otherwise, she would not have said so many rebellious things to me and only angrily lectured me. Apart from the difficulty in accepting it for a while, she did not resist."

611, with a vague understanding: "Is the host worried that if Lady Xie Yuan has the opportunity to leave, she won't choose you? But 611 feels that she treats you very well."

Song Ling scoffed: "Being good to me and whether she will abandon me are two different things. What I want is for her to always be by my side, not for her so-called being good to me."

"But he left me."

611 witnessed firsthand how the host crawled out of a mountain of corpses and a sea of ​​blood from the moment it was awakened. It had died countless times and killed countless people, but it did all this for only one person.

It belongs to the category of destruction and devouring restriction systems, possessing the ability to interfere with the operation mechanism of the Heavenly Dao in small worlds. Among countless worlds, it is the only one with extremely destructive power.

However, awakening it is extremely difficult, requiring immense hatred, resentment, and despair...

The host single-handedly destroyed countless people in parallel worlds...

611 confidently declared, "Host, don't worry, I'm very capable, I can definitely help..."

"The kind of help you're talking about, is it going to other worlds every day to drink and eat meat, or to listen to operas and watch music?"

611 gave an awkward laugh: "Host, so you knew all along..."

"After playing with shapeshifting for so long, it's time to get down to work."

In the void, a handsome young man in white slowly materialized from the air: "Host, do you want to kill someone? I'm good at that." His tone was quite like a child's smug pride.

"I'll leave the Wujian Pavilion to you. It's just a piece of trash who's blessed with good fortune and protected by the Heavenly Dao, and has never had a care in the world."

611's eyes were filled with admiration: "Don't worry, host, 611 guarantees to complete the mission!"

A bone flute shrouded in ghostly energy appeared in Song Ling's hand at some unknown time.

611 was terrified at the sight of that bone flute. Oh dear, the host was even more terrifying than this system!

"Host, I'll be going now!"

611 fled the consciousness space as if escaping.

Song Ling gently stroked the bone flute, its texture as cold as jade, and could almost still feel the despair, anger, and resentment of being torn apart as she was killed...

There can be countless Song dynasties.

There can only be one Song Ling.

The master belongs to him and can only belong to him.

You can only blame yourselves for not being lucky enough to meet her.

The underground sacrificial site in the northern suburbs of Wuli Town.

Deep within the dark and cold underground cave, five stone pillars carved with strange and unknown totems stand here. In the center, a large group of women kneeling with their faces covered by white headscarves are kneeling.

Without exception, they knelt in the center of the sacrificial array, their eyes vacant and blank.

The black-robed man standing outside the formation skillfully pressed a button on one of the stone arrays.

Countless dense black insects rustled and swarmed over the area with pinpoint accuracy, without any earth-shattering howls or hysterical screams.

As the black swarm of insects receded, only white bones remained, kneeling and bowing their heads on the ground.

The man in black robes, unfazed, gave instructions to his subordinate standing beside him.

"The sacrifices here will be suspended for a while. Too many people are dying and it will be difficult to manage. After the livers of those boys are removed, remember to freeze them and store them in the ice cellar. Use the bodies to feed the insects."

"Yes." The man in black robes, who had been given the order, accepted it and quickly led his group away.

Soon only the black-robed man remained in the cave. He turned around, fumbled around on the stone wall for a while, and pressed another mechanism. With a loud bang, a group of young girls, barely clothed and draped in light gauze, shivered from the cold and looked terrified, appeared behind the door.

The man in black robes laughed lewdly. He had finally managed to cut corners and keep these girls for his own amusement, and now he could finally have some fun.

"Pfft"

A sharp dagger swiftly pierced his heart from behind.

He stared wide-eyed in disbelief.

On his deathbed, he heard only a cheerful young voice and a somewhat distressed sigh behind him.

"Killing people in white is really inconvenient; looks like I'll need to spend more money in the future..."
